James Harden, in his own way, is on a historic hot streak.
So, he’s intensifying his rhetoric about Most Valuable Player.

Harden might be the NBA’s steadiest MVP candidate. In the last four years, he has three top-two finishes, including winning the award last season.
After a slow start, Harden is back in the race this season. I’d still call Giannis Antetokounmpo favorite, and plenty of others – including LeBron James, Anthony Davis and Stephen Curry – are in the mix.
But so is Harden, and I don’t mind him stating his personal ambitions. He drives the Rockets. Chasing this award will only help Houston. This is not a player choosing personal goals over team goals. They go hand-in-hand.
So, if Harden declaring his intent to win MVP motivates him, good for him – and the Rockets.
